Ranchi: BJP National President Nitin Nabin arrived in Ranchi on Saturday on a two-day visit to Jharkhand. This is Nabin’s first visit to Jharkhand after becoming the party’s national president, a party official said. During his stay, Nabin will take part in several party events and organisational meetings, he said. Nabin was given a grand welcome by senior BJP leaders, including Jharkhand BJP president Aditya Sahu, Union minister Sanjay Seth and former chief ministers Arjun Munda, Raghubar Das and Champai Soren at Ranchi’s Birsa Munda Airport. Nabin offered floral tributes to the statue of tribal icon Birsa Munda at Birsa Chowk in Ranchi. “Visiting Jharkhand is coming home for me,” Nabin told reporters.
He reached the party headquarters in Ranchi, where he is scheduled to hold a meeting with members of parliament (MPs), members of the legislative assembly (MLAs) and the party’s core committee members. Later, he will participate in a ‘Prabuddhjan Samvad’ (dialogue with intellectuals). Jharkhand BJP general secretary Amar Bauri said the party’s national president will visit Bokaro on June 7. Later, he will hold meetings with district presidents, in-charges and party officials in Ranchi, he added.
Nabin’s visit comes ahead of the elections to the two Rajya Sabha seats in Jharkhand. The last date for filing nominations is June 8, and the election day is June 18. One of the seats fell vacant following the death of JMM co-founder Shibu Soren, while BJP’s Deepak Prakash, who holds the other seat, will complete his six-year term on June 21.
